A full container handler which is unparalleled in lifting capacity and efficiency is referred to as a Caterpillar Container Handler.
By combining stability, modern technology and high performance, Caterpillar Container handlers are the best choice for unloading and loading full containers. Container Handlers range from 24 tons to 43 tons. Options include high-mounted cabin in the middle or low-mounted cabin at the front for the excellent visibility and handling.
Rough Terrain Forklift
The rough terrain forklift is best for applications at construction sites and different locations where there is no paved surface. This particular type of forklift is used to transport materials around lumberyards.
These types of forklifts are truly meant for rough terrain. Nonetheless, the equipment is top heavy and should be handled carefully in rough places. The machine should be level with all tires on the ground when lifting.
Steering is more difficult at faster speeds. The Occupational Safety and Health Administration does not set speed restrictions on forklifts. Nevertheless, operators are responsible for operating forklifts at a safe speed, specially when driving on rough terrain and when turning.
Not lifting a load while operating on an incline would avoid a tip over. The load must be on the uphill side of the equipment when driving up a slope. If driving down an incline, it is good safety practice to back down.
